Analysis
The most recent figure for total fao — fibreboard — export quantity in Netherlands Antilles (former) is 179 m3, measured in 2010. That is the highest value across all 6 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 4.1% on the previous year and up 17.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, total fao — fibreboard — export quantity in Netherlands Antilles (former) peaked at 179 m3 in 2010 and was at its lowest, 152 m3, in 1997.
Netherlands Antilles (former) ranks 81st of 124 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
